현대 OS에서는 Long term scheduler, Mid term scheduler, 안쓰인대

Short term scheduler만 쓰인대

 

글구 Virtual Memory가 하드 디스크를 메모리처럼 쓰는거라구 했자나.

이게 얼케 가능? 했는데 생각해보니까 프로세스는 원래 잘게 쪼개져있잖아?

그럼 필요한 부분만 그냥 하드 디스크에 내리면 되는거 아닐까?

=Swapped Memory(?)

생각해보면, Memory Swap을 할 때, Swap을 위한 공간을 미리 만들어두잖아?

그럼 그게 메모리 주소 체계의 공간인가봄?

생각해보니 그건 아닐듯? 그냥 중간에 테이블 하나 둬서 가상의 메모리 주소를 하드디스크 물리 주소랑 연결할거같음.

 

https://mozi.tistory.com/424

 

[LINUX] 물리메모리를 전부 사용하지 않았는데 SWAP 영역을 사용하는 원인

이슈상황 1 2 3 4 5 $ free              total       used       free     shared    buffers     cached Mem:      32901680   29978376    2923304 ..

mozi.tistory.com

 

  • 네이버 블러그 공유하기
  • 네이버 밴드에 공유하기
  • 페이스북 공유하기
  • 카카오스토리 공유하기